Abstract
Isobaric vapor–liquid-equilibrium (VLE) data at 101.33 kPa for the system formed by benzene, n-heptane and N,N-dimethylformamide (DMF) are reported. Data reduction has been carried out through Wilson, NRTL, and UNIQUAC thermodynamic models for correlating the liquid-phase activity coefficients. Activity coefficients of the components in the mixture indicate positive deviations from Raoult’s law. Experimental results show that DMF is a good extractive solvent that reverses the volatility of the binary system benzene+n-heptane.
